Cleaning Performance

The Roomba 105 Vac Robot Vacuum boasts a powerful 70X more power-lifting suction compared to previous Roomba models, making it highly effective in picking up dirt and dust from various surfaces. In contrast, the SereneLife Robot Vacuum Cleaner and Mop Combo offers a dual function with its 3000Pa suction power, enabling it to vacuum and mop simultaneously. This 2-in-1 capability means that the SereneLife can provide a deeper clean in one pass, making it an appealing choice for those who want to tackle both dust and spills efficiently.

Navigation capabilities differ significantly between the two models. The Roomba 105 features advanced ClearView LiDAR technology that quickly maps your home and cleans in neat rows, even in the dark. This smart navigation helps it avoid obstacles effectively. On the other hand, the SereneLife model has smart sensors that ensure safe navigation, but it does not specify advanced mapping technology. While both robots are designed to navigate effectively, the Roomba’s superior mapping technology may provide a more thorough and logical cleaning path in complex environments.

Control Options

When it comes to controlling the robots, the Roomba 105 offers three easy ways: through voice commands with Alexa, Siri, or Google Assistant, using the Roomba Home App, or controlling it directly on the device. This versatility can be particularly useful for users who prefer hands-free operation. Meanwhile, the SereneLife provides a smart app and a remote control for cleaning schedules and modes. Although both options offer app control, the additional voice command feature of the Roomba 105 enhances its convenience for tech-savvy users.

Customization and Scheduling

The Roomba 105 allows for extensive customization, enabling users to schedule cleanings, target specific rooms, and adjust cleaning passes and suction levels based on their daily routine. This feature allows for tailored cleaning experiences that can adapt to different areas of the home. Conversely, the SereneLife offers four cleaning modes—Auto, Zig-Zag, Spot, and Edge—allowing for some level of customization, but it appears less versatile than the Roomba in terms of scheduling and targeted cleaning options.

The SereneLife Robot Vacuum Cleaner, with its ultra-slim profile of 2.95 inches, also excels in design, allowing it to slide under furniture with ease. Battery Life and Charging

The Roomba 105 has a feature that allows it to recharge and resume cleaning tasks, ensuring that it completes its job without interruption. This is particularly beneficial for larger homes or more intensive cleaning schedules. The SereneLife model also returns to its charging dock automatically when the battery is low, which is a standard feature in robotic vacuums. However, the Roomba’s ability to pick up where it left off gives it an edge in efficiency and reliability for thorough cleanings.
